Coffee taste and aroma are largely determined by the conditions the coffee was grown, how that coffee was manufactured, and how the coffee was roasted. For example, coffee grown high on mountains generally has a more fruitlike taste because the beans have to fight harder to grow. Mass-produced coffee will taste less impactful, more watery, and ...

But with our fast-paced lives, finding the time to go to a café and wait in line f...Here are 5 things you can add to your brew that might help it taste less bitter: 1. Add a Fat. Fats help counteract the bitterness in coffee. Adding milk, almond milk, oat milk, soy milk, cream, ice cream, or even butter will reduce bitterness and round out other flavors in your cup of coffee.Yes, your tongue can be tattooed. While some coffees have a natural citrus acidity, other coffees ...Here are five things to look out for when brewing your morning cup. 1. Your coffee beans are stale. Roasted coffee beans oxidize with exposure to oxygen, and this leads to them becoming stale. You want fresh beans, so you want to make sure to keep them away from oxygen, moisture, heat and light.Jan 9, 2024 · Matcha Tea. Water temperature plays a key role in coffee brewing, and if it’s too hot you’ll extract the bitter compounds. According to the National Coffee Association, 195°F to 205°F is ideal for optimal extraction. Water boils at 212°F, so in layman’s terms, that means not letting your water overboil, and letting it sit ...

Advertisement Tattoos have come a lo...Light: Also known as a cinnamon roast, light roasts have the most acidity and the highest caffeine content. When making coffee with a light roast, you will get a thinner body in your resulting cup and be able to taste more of the fruity or floral notes in the coffee. This method tends to result in a fuller-bodied brew with a slightly higher oil content, which can contribute to a smoother taste and reduce bitterness. 3.Causes of Sour Coffee. 1. Under Extraction. One common cause of sour coffee is under extracting during the brewing process. This happens when not enough flavor is taken out of the coffee grounds while brewing.
